1, the design of the stamping parts must meet the product use and technical performance, and can be easy to assemble and repair.
2, the design of stamping parts must be conducive to improve the utilization rate of metal materials, reduce the variety and specifications of materials, as far as possible to reduce the consumption of materials. Use cheap materials where possible to make parts as scrap free and less scrap blanking.
3, the design of stamping parts must be simple shape, reasonable structure, in order to help simplify the mould structure, simplify the process, which is the least, the most simple stamping process to complete the entire parts processing, reduce processing with other methods, and is advantageous to the stamping operations, is advantageous for the organization to realize mechanization and automation production, in order to improve labor productivity.
4, the design of stamping parts, in the case of normal use, try to make the size accuracy level and surface roughness level requirements are lower, and conducive to the exchange of products, reduce waste, to ensure the stability of product quality.
5, the design of stamping parts, should be conducive to the use of existing equipment, process equipment and process flow for processing, and is conducive to the extension of the service life of the die.
